Overview

In the age of digital omnipresence, keeping kids safe from the pervasive power of peer pressure is becoming increasingly critical. 'Peer Pressure Pandemic: Keeping Kids Safe in a Digital World' by Raymond Graham, an experienced educator and a compassionate digital literacy advocate, is an insightful and compelling guide through this complex landscape. Immerse yourself in a deep exploration of the digital universe, which our children traverse daily. Recognize the strong undercurrents of online peer pressure, and discover practical strategies to help kids navigate through this universe safely. Not just instilling fear, this report aims to empower you with knowledge and actionable advice. Understanding the Digital Landscape: Get to grips with the vast, intriguing world of social media and the internet that our children are growing up in. The Psychological Impact of Online Interactions: Understand how digital interactions affect children's mental health, self-esteem, and perspectives. Parenting in the Age of Digital Overload: Equip yourself with effective strategies for parenting in an era where technology seems to have taken over every aspect of life. Strategies for Dealing with Cyberbullying: Learn how to identify and effectively respond to instances of online bullying - a harmful byproduct of peer pressure. Empowering Kids for Better Digital Citizenship: Discover how to teach children the skills to become responsible, thoughtful, and safety-minded digital citizens.
